“You’ve got two bowls to grab whatever you like in any quantity- proteins, veggies, and sauces as long as you can fill the bowl. Just place your ingredients on the counter and the chef will cook them for you. Ice cream, soup, white rice, chips are available at self-service bar. friendly staff. The counter area is neat and clean, and the spacious room has plenty of seats. Located in the main road in Santa Cruz, this is a great choice if you want to assemble your own meal. Plus you can decide your own saltiness and spices or try their sauce recipes as per your taste.“
